The Traditional Approach: Coinbase 50 Index

Debuting in November 2024, the Coinbase 50 Index (COIN50) introduced new options for mainstream crypto market tracking. In collaboration with MarketVector Indexes, this index targets the top 50 digital assets available on Coinbase, representing around 80% of total crypto market capitalization. Its methodology is deliberately straightforward: a market-cap weighted approach, refreshed every quarter to reflect shifting capitalizations.

Presently, COIN50 is highly concentrated—Bitcoin anchors the index at 50% (maximum permitted), followed by Ethereum, Solana, and other leading assets. This mirrors the top-heavy nature of crypto markets. The approach is simple: buy, hold, rebalance—mirroring passive equity index philosophies that focus on capturing long-term growth despite short-term volatility.

The Intelligence Gap

While COIN50 reliably tracks the market, it shares a critical limitation with traditional stock indices: remaining fully invested regardless of market direction. In stock markets, this risk can often be managed because drawdowns are typically less severe. Crypto markets, however, frequently experience far deeper corrections—drawdowns in excess of 70% occurred during the 2022 crypto winter. In such environments, a fully invested index is vulnerable to significant capital erosion.

This is less a flaw and more a design trade-off inherent to passive strategies. As cycles accelerate in 2025 and volatility persists, crypto market participants are increasingly asking whether a more adaptive approach could offer better outcomes in terms of drawdown mitigation while maintaining growth potential.

What is the main difference between Coinbase 50 and TM Global 100?

The COIN50 is a market-cap-weighted index of the top 50 cryptocurrencies, with quarterly rebalancing and a passive buy-and-hold approach. TM Global 100 expands coverage to 100 assets, rebalances weekly, and uses regime switching to adjust exposure based on market signals, offering more active risk management.

How does regime switching improve crypto index performance?

Regime switching enables the index to shift out of risk assets and into stablecoins during bearish market conditions, potentially limiting large drawdowns. This approach aims to provide smoother performance across cycles rather than maximization in any single period.

Can I access TM Global 100 if I’m in the US?

The TM Global 100 is structured as a spot index, increasing accessibility for U.S. residents. In contrast, COIN50 is available primarily through derivative products outside of the U.S., requiring access to specific international exchanges and experience with futures contracts.

How It Works (Under the Hood)

Quantmetrics computes risk-adjusted performance over a chosen lookback (e.g., 30d, 90d, 1y). You’ll receive a JSON snapshot with core statistics:

  • Sharpe ratio: excess return per unit of total volatility.
  • Sortino ratio: penalizes downside volatility more than upside.
  • Volatility: standard deviation of returns over the window.
  • Max drawdown: worst peak-to-trough decline.
  • CAGR / performance snapshot: geometric growth rate and best/worst periods.

Call /v2/quantmetrics?symbol=<ASSET>&window=<LOOKBACK> to fetch the current snapshot. For dashboards spanning many tokens, batch symbols and apply short-TTL caching. If you generate alerts (e.g., “Sharpe crossed 1.5”), run a scheduled job and queue notifications to avoid bursty polling.

Production Checklist

  • Rate limits: Understand your tier caps; add client-side throttling and queues.
  • Retries & backoff: Exponential backoff with jitter; treat 429/5xx as transient.
  • Idempotency: Prevent duplicate downstream actions on retried jobs.
  • Caching: Memory/Redis/KV with short TTLs; pre-warm popular symbols and windows.
  • Batching: Fetch multiple symbols per cycle; parallelize carefully within limits.
  • Error catalog: Map 4xx/5xx to clear remediation; log request IDs for tracing.
  • Observability: Track p95/p99 latency and error rates; alert on drift.
  • Security: Store API keys in secrets managers; rotate regularly.

4) Which lookback window should I choose?

Short windows (30–90d) adapt faster but are noisier; longer windows (6–12m) are steadier but slower to react. Offer users a toggle and cache each window.
